Stepping into the Sterkfontein Caves is like entering a different world—one that holds the secrets of our shared ancestry. As you descend 2.5 kilometers into the limestone labyrinth, the cool subterranean air and soft golden light create an almost sacred atmosphere .
The first thing that strikes you is the sheer weight of history. These aren't just any caves; this is where "Mrs. Ples," a 2.1-million-year-old Australopithecus africanus skull, was discovered in 1947, and where the near-complete "Little Foot" skeleton was found in 1997 . As you walk the twisting pathways past towering stalactites and stalagmites formed over millions of years, it's humbling to stand in the same chambers where early hominins once sought shelter .

Sterkfontein Caves Early Discoveries: The caves' scientific importance was recognized in the late 19th century when miners uncovered fossils. Systematic excavations began in the 1930s.Key Fossil Finds: "Mrs. Ples," a nearly complete Australopithecus africanus skull, was discovered in 1947 by Dr. Robert Broom. "Little Foot," a nearly complete Australopithecus skeleton, was found in the 1990s by Ronald J. Clarke. Ongoing Significance: Sterkfontein is one of the richest sites for early hominin fossils, providing crucial evidence for understanding human evolution. Management: The University of the Witwatersrand has been instrumental in managing and conducting research at the Sterkfontein Caves since 1966. Recent Developments: The caves were closed in 2022 due to flooding and reopened to the public on April 15, 2025. Maropeng Purpose: Maropeng, meaning "returning to the place of origin" in Setswana, is the official visitor center for the Cradle of Humankind.
